Cave of Pan

The cave of Pan is located on the eastern side of the Platanias Gorge. It was named so, because according to a local legend, the ancient god Panas, who is considered the patron of livestock, was born there. Inside the cave, there are petroglyphs that date back to the Minoan period and suggest that the site had a cultic significance even back then.
